Aboriginal people in the Thompson River region, particularly the Nlaka'pamux Nation, were aware of gold long before it was officially discovered by settlers. Gold was first discovered by European settlers in the area during the Fraser River Gold Rush in 1858, when miners began to explore the Thompson River. The indigenous peoples had long utilized the river's resources, but it was the influx of settlers that marked the beginning of significant gold mining activities in the region.

No, gold was not discovered in California in 1848 at the Snake River. The significant gold discovery in California occurred at Sutter's Mill near Coloma in January 1848, which sparked the California Gold Rush. The Snake River is located in Idaho and is not associated with the initial gold discoveries that led to the rush in California.

James Nash is the prospector credited with finding the first payable gold on he Mary River near Gympie, Queensland. His discovery sparked the first major goldrush in Queensland, and led to Gympie being named "The Town that saved Queensland".
